Using a semiclassical rescattering model, the momentum distribution of recoil ions from laser-induced nonsequential double ionization is obtained and the result is consistent with the experiment reported recently. We show that the characteristic double-hump structure of the recoil momentum distribution of the He2+ ion parallel to the polarization axis is just the consequence of the rescattering dynamic of nonsequential double ionization and the acceleration of the ions in the laser field.
